The balancing act: Identifying multivariate sports performance using Pareto frontiers.
Tim Newans1,2, Phillip Bellinger1, Clare Minahan1
1Griffith Sports Science, Griffith University, Gold Coast, QLD, Australia.
Pareto frontiers identify elite athletes balancing multiple, often conflicting, sports metrics. This method highlights players with optimal performance across various attributes, not just single-metric leaders, enhancing talent evaluation in sports like cricket.
Area of Science:
- Sports Science
- Data Analytics
- Performance Optimization
Background:
- Athletes require a complex interplay of physical, physiological, psychological, and skill attributes.
- Conflicting attributes pose challenges for identifying top performers at elite levels.
- Traditional single-metric analysis may overlook athletes with balanced, multi-attribute excellence.
Purpose of the Study:
- To introduce Pareto frontiers as a method for identifying athletes with optimal multi-attribute balance.
- To explore trade-offs between key batting and bowling metrics in Twenty20 cricket.
- To demonstrate the utility of Pareto frontiers in talent assessment.
Main Methods:
- Applied Pareto frontier analysis to batting average vs. strike rate.
- Analyzed bowling strike rate, economy, and average using Pareto frontiers.
- Utilized data from 891 matches across the men's (MBBL) and women's (WBBL) Australian Big Bash Leagues.
Main Results:
- Identified 12 optimal batting innings and 9 optimal careers in MBBL; 7 optimal innings and 6 optimal careers in WBBL.
- Identified 3 optimal bowling innings and 5 optimal careers in MBBL; 3 optimal innings and 6 optimal careers in WBBL.
- Found optimal players who did not lead in any single metric when analyzed univariately.
Conclusions:
- Pareto frontiers effectively identify athletes with a balanced optimal profile across multiple, potentially conflicting, metrics.
- This technique is valuable for talent identification, especially when metrics are uncorrelated or negatively correlated.
- The study showcases Pareto frontiers as a robust tool for multi-metric sports performance analysis.
